Medication
ADHD medications, such as stimulants, enhance signs and assist people function more efficiently. They might likewise reduce some of the unfavorable side results of ADHD, such as problem sleeping and bad appetite. Medication is not the only treatment for ADHD, but it is an essential part of a detailed strategy. An individual needs to talk about a medication plan with his/her mental health expert.
Psychiatrists have actually advanced training in the diagnosis and treatment of psychiatric disorders, including ADHD. They are normally the best option for a person with ADHD, especially if it is comorbid with depression, severe stress and anxiety or another major condition.
In addition to medication, a psychiatrist can prescribe psychotherapy for ADHD patients. This kind of treatment can include c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T), which helps individuals change the negative thoughts and behaviors that trigger issues in their lives. CBT can likewise teach individuals beneficial abilities, such as planning and time management, to help them manage their ADHD better.
A psychiatric nurse specialist (NP) is another kind of mental health professional with comprehensive training and experience in diagnosing and treating ADHD and common comorbid conditions. Like psychiatrists, NPs are comfortable prescribing psychiatric medications and can deal with patients to create a general treatment strategy.

A person who has a neurological condition that triggers attention deficit disorder (ADHD) can experience a wide variety of symptoms, including difficulty following directions, organizing their work or home, and being on time for meetings. These problems can affect an individual's ability to operate at school or at work, and can cause relationship problems.
Some individuals with a diagnosis of ADHD feel that their peers and coworkers think they slouch or absence commitment. These unfavorable sensations can result in an increase in stress and anxiety and depression. Individuals with ADHD also struggle to express anger in a healthy way, and this can cause spontaneous habits that hurt those around them. Anger management is an essential part of ADHD-focused psychotherapy.
